Model-based systems engineering (MBSE) unlocks a whole new way of orchestrating your aerospace and defense engineering operations. Using a model-based approach drives greater insights throughout the program and builds more effective connections and scalable processes to get all players working together in new ways. It’s a vast step beyond document-centric methods that required a lot more work.

This video is part three of a five-video series about how organizations can use model-based systems engineering (MBSE) to innovate successfully. It mirrors chapter three of MBSE For Dummies, Siemens Special Edition.

Chapter three explores how the digital thread links domains and changes work routines. It outlines how MBSE orchestrates a technical program while allowing experts within their respective domains to keep using the tools they like, and it describes ways your processes and results can improve.
